Hey guys, looking for some advice here. I recently finished a box that I used water based dye on. I followed the instructions for mixing the dye and applied it on my project. It looked great. The wood I used was ash. after letting the dye dry for 24 hours, I tried to apply minwax polycrylic water based polyurethene. When I did this, the dye I had applied started bleading all over. What did I do wrong? do I need to let it dry longer? can I not use water based poly over water based dye. My understanging was that I could use any finish over the dye. Help

Howard Acheson
03-15-2008, 9:57 AM
Of course, the water in your waterborne finish dissolved your water soluble dye. That's going to happen. If you want to use a waterborne finish over a water or alcohol soluble dye, you should first apply a coat of shellac as a barrier coat. If you plan to use a waterborne finish or an oil based poly varnish be sure to use a dewaxed shellac.

If your box is small enough, go to your local big box and buy a can or two of Zinsser's Spray Can Shellac. It's totally dewaxed and easy to apply. For a larger item use Zinsser's Sealcoat which is a 100% dewaxed shellac.
